Hi,

 

In the "metadata manager" use the "Advanced refresh button" after you have selected a top tier media item (ie. 'Movies').

 

You can also select the advanced refresh button from any of the child folders you have selected, as it will appear for every item in the metadata manager.

 

If you don't mind using the extra space on your server drives, I would suggest allowing emby to save images locally. This will make sure the images are readily available for the library scans.

 

This option can be found under the "metadata" configuration in the left slide out menu of the server. Listed as the first option under "Basics".

 

 

Note: Sometimes if emby has to scrape all the images from the Internet each time, for large collections it may miss some. In this case it will create a folder image from the video file. This is what you are experiencing. Saving locally will stop that from happening.

 

After you have used the advanced refresh, run the "Scan Media Libraray" scheduled task.

I recommend using Couch Potato to control your movie downloads and ingestion.  You can integrate it with SABNZBD to download the file, CouchPotato then picks it up, renames it and dumps it directly into a folder on your target movie share.  Emby will then scan it from there.  It's all automated, just need to add the movie you want into couchpotato.

Having a similar problem. A bunch of movies which correctly identified still lack some artwork, or have low resolution artwork downloaded.

 

Manually editing the movie, re-identifying with 'replace images' checkbox ticked, it then downloads the missing/low res poster in higher resolution, possibly more artwork.

 

Trying using the metadata manager and using the advanced refresh button to 'refresh all data' and 'replace existing images' on the root 'movies' folder, but it doesn't appear to have done anything. Manually done most of the movies I've noticed missing posters, but that doesn't cover movies that missed other artwork / have lower res artwork that I just haven't noticed yet. I've deliberately not updated one movie without poster manually at this point as my check to verify if the scans are doing anything.
